SK Magic unveiled a limited edition collaboration product, the 'SK Magic X PSG ultra-compact direct water purifier,' with the world-renowned football club Paris Saint-Germain FC (PSG) and announced a giveaway event to celebrate the launch on the 6th.

PSG is a prestigious football club representing Paris, France, and has recorded the most championships in Ligue 1. The club has a strong fanbase among football fans both in Korea and globally, having recruited world-renowned football stars including South Korea national team player Lee Kang-in, Ousmane Dembélé, Marquinhos, Achraf Hakimi, and Gianluigi Donnarumma.

Last month, SK Magic, which signed a partnership with PSG, launched a limited edition collaboration 'ultra-compact direct water purifier' reflecting the PSG brand identity and premium image.

The ultra-compact direct water purifier is the first in South Korea to apply a 'stainless steel vacuum system' to enhance hygiene, reducing its size by 40% compared to existing direct water purifiers, making it installable even in narrow spaces. SK Magic aimed to encapsulate the clarity of the purifier along with PSG's bright and healthy image and vibrant energy. The trendy and sophisticated design captures the essence of PSG's home city, Paris, France.

A representative from SK Magic noted, "This product is perfect not only for sports enthusiasts who love PSG but also for customers wanting unique and stylish interiors that reflect the essence of Paris, France," adding, "We plan to introduce various products reflecting the PSG brand identity in the future."
